Industry
Information Services, Foreign exchange brokers and dealers, Financial and insurance services, Business Services, Brokers, futures and options, interest rates, foreign exchange, Financial Industry Supplies, Management & Consulting
HQ Location
7 Harp Lane, 5th Floor
London, City of London EC3R 6DP, GB